While Tommy Boyce and Bobby Hart produced the album and created the Monkees' 'sound,' the backing vocals were also done by the duo (although Peter can be heard singing along with them on "Let's Dance On"!)...Although "Gonna Buy Me a Dog," is perceived as merely a novelty number, it is, along with Nez' tunes (who had the other group members sing background vocals), one of the few songs that actually represented the group, featuring Micky and Davy lampooning the number and doing what they do best: comedic improv...In fact, Mike also recorded a rockin' unreleased version of it at the time!!

You cannot identify with us who were kids in 1966 when the Monkees premiered. There was nothing else like it on TV, and we all fell in love with 4 cute, funny boys. And they sang great! Before the Monkees, the only way to see the artists performing their hits was to catch a guest appearance on a variety show, usually at the very end of the hour. Monkees fans generally love them more than the Beatles, because the Beatles were for our older siblings, not us. Then the Beatles progressed into this weird, druggy music that we kids didn't relate to, and they were so much older, at least that's how I felt. I didn't collect pictures of Paul McCartney; he dated Jane Asher and was a grown man. But Davy Jones? Now, he was something special! We could watch our Monkees every week, save allowances to buy their records, and read about them in Tiger Beat and Sixteen magazines. There has really been nothing like that since!
